the function y = f(x) is graphed below. what is the average rate of change of the function f(x) on the interval 1 ≤ x ≤ 2?

Explanation:

Step1: Recall average - rate - of - change formula

The average rate of change of a function $y = f(x)$ on the interval $[a,b]$ is $\frac{f(b)-f(a)}{b - a}$. Here, $a = 1$ and $b = 2$.

Step2: Find $f(1)$ and $f(2)$ from the graph

From the graph, when $x = 1$, $f(1)=10$. When $x = 2$, $f(2)=0$.

Step3: Calculate the average rate of change

Substitute $a = 1$, $b = 2$, $f(1)=10$, and $f(2)=0$ into the formula: $\frac{f(2)-f(1)}{2 - 1}=\frac{0 - 10}{1}=- 10$.

Answer:

$-10$
